What are considered pan fish?

One early-20th-century source identifies all the following as panfish: yellow perch, candlefish, balaos, sand launces, rock bass, bullheads, minnows, Rocky Mountain whitefish, sand rollers, crappie, yellow bass, white bass, croaker and most of the common small sunfishes such as bluegill and redear sunfish.

Additionally, why is it called a pan fish?

Webster’s defines panfish as: “A small food fish usually taken with hook and line and not available on the market.” The style manual of the Outdoor Writers Association of America takes a different approach: “Any of a variety of species of fish that resemble the shape of a frying pan, thus the name.”

Are bluegill good eating?

Does Bluegill Taste Good? Although they are small (usually 10 inches or less), Bluegill is considered a top choice among the sunfish family for cooking and taste quality. The meat is mild, firm, and an excellent choice both as a formal dinner or camp meal. It does not have a fishy taste.

Are crappie the same as perch?

Crappie have a taller, more flattened body shape than yellow perch. A crappie also has large dorsal and anal fins. The dorsal and anal fins on a crappie start with six to eight spines depending on the species and end in a large rounded lobe. Crappie have one dorsal fin, while perch have two.

What kind of fish is a crappie?

crappie, either of two freshwater North American fishes of the genus Pomoxis, family Centrarchidae (order Perciformes). Crappies are rather deep-bodied fishes that are popular as food and are prized by sport fishermen. They are native to the eastern United States but have been introduced elsewhere.

What is the best bait for panfish?

The most common baits are worms and night crawlers because they are readily available and bluegill love them. The key is to use only a piece of a worm—just enough to cover the hook. Other productive baits include crickets, grasshoppers, red wrigglers and meal worms. Artificial lures also work well for bluegill.

Are trout a panfish?

Generally speaking, sought after game fish such as Largemouth Bass (Micropterus salmoides), Smallmouth Bass (Micropterus dolomieu) and various Trout are not considered Panfish…but who’s to say they can’t be? This is where it really comes down to angler preference and regional customs.
